Handover: ScanPort integration

Taking over from me is straightforward. ScanPort talks to the Lintfield warehouse scanners over a mutual-TLS channel; certs rotate quarterly via the Hollybrook vault job. Audit logging is on by default and shouldn't be disabled. For your review, the service currently runs with the following configuration values.

settings of yageg-yahap:
[gorael]
team = olieth
access_code = ac_941d74
owner = brieth.aldiel
host = gorael.tolvaqio.internal
port = 6379
peer = briwyn.urlaqtech.internal
salt = 116e6622
pin = 1957

Two custodians must be present; verify both against the custodian roster before proceeding. Generate the keypair on the air-gapped laptop, confirm the fingerprint aloud, and record it in the ceremony log. Seal the hardware token in the tamper-evident bag. Before sealing, the token must be initialized with the recovery passphrase written directly below.

recovery phrase for tawef-bawef: ralath-jorius-casok-julok

Handover: Spoolhawk Microservice

From Tamsin to Orrik, for new team members. Spoolhawk handles print-job queuing for the Velmora office fleet. Known quirk: the retry worker deadlocks if the queue exceeds 10k jobs; drain via the admin CLI first. Admin CLI access requires unlocking the ops keyring with the passphrase below.

strongbox words: briiel-zoreth-noveth-pelys-druwyn-feniel-lamvan-ulaius-kasion

/*
 * Welcome, plugin authors! These constants govern how Switchyard
 * rolls your flags out to real traffic. You generally shouldn't
 * override them — the defaults took a few painful incidents to
 * get right — but if your plugin does gradual rollouts of its own,
 * please mirror this pacing so operators see consistent behavior
 * across the whole system. Questions go in the contributor channel.
 * The defaults are defined just below.
 */

constants for bagag-fawip:
BUDGETS = {
    "wenius": 400,
    "brieth": 224,
    "rusath": 783,
    "eliys": 187,
    "aldax": 737,
    "ralion": 818,
    "istius": 153,
}